Raul Marte is a 23-year-old football player who plays as a right back for SW Bregenz, born on 23. maaliskuuta 2002, who is right-footed. Follow Raul Marte on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
In the 2025/2026 2. Liga season, Raul Marte has recorded 0 goals, 2 assists, 1 123 minutes, 2 yellow cards.
Raul Marte scores highly on Assists and Minutes compared to right backs in the 2. Liga.

Raul Marte's career has also included time at Dornbirn, Austria Lustenau, and SC Austria Lustenau II.

Throughout their career, Raul Marte has won 1 title: 2. Liga (2021/2022) with Austria Lustenau.
